Levothyroxine: Understanding Your Prescription

Always take your levothyroxine at the same time each day, preferably before breakfast on an empty stomach. This ensures consistent absorption.

Your doctor will determine the correct dosage based on your individual needs. Never adjust your dosage without consulting them. Changes require careful monitoring.

Different brands may have varying absorption rates. If you change brands, discuss this with your doctor. Consistency is key for stable thyroid hormone levels.

Report any side effects, such as rapid heartbeat, weight changes, or changes in mood, to your doctor immediately. These can indicate dosage needs adjustment.

Certain medications, including antacids, can interfere with levothyroxine absorption. Take levothyroxine at least four hours before or after these other medications.

Keep your levothyroxine in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and heat. This will help preserve its potency.

Regular blood tests are necessary to monitor your thyroid hormone levels and adjust your medication as needed. Follow your doctor’s instructions regarding blood tests.

Inform your doctor about any pre-existing health conditions or other medications you are taking. This helps in determining the optimal dosage and preventing interactions.

Always refill your prescription before you run out to ensure a continuous supply of your medication. Maintain consistent medication levels to avoid fluctuations.

If you have any questions or concerns about your levothyroxine prescription, contact your doctor or pharmacist for clarification. They are available to provide personalized guidance.

Understanding Levothyroxine Costs and Insurance Coverage

Check your insurance plan’s formulary. This list specifies covered medications and their cost-sharing levels (copay, coinsurance). Generic levothyroxine is typically much cheaper than brand-name options.

Factors Affecting Levothyroxine Cost

  • Pharmacy: Prices vary significantly between pharmacies. Compare prices using online tools or by calling several pharmacies.
  • Dosage and Quantity: Higher dosages and larger quantities usually increase the cost.
  • Brand vs. Generic: Generic levothyroxine is bioequivalent to brand-name versions but significantly less expensive. Your doctor can confirm whether switching is safe for you.
  • Manufacturer: Even within generic medications, prices can differ slightly based on the manufacturer.

Potential Side Effects and Interactions of Levothyroxine

Levothyroxine, while generally safe and effective, can cause side effects. Common ones include headache, weight changes, increased bowel movements, and changes in menstrual cycles. Less frequent, but still possible, are palpitations, tremors, and insomnia. Severe reactions are rare.

Certain foods and medications can interfere with levothyroxine absorption. Avoid taking it with calcium supplements, iron, or antacids. Soy products and high-fiber foods may also reduce absorption. Consult your doctor about potential interactions with other prescriptions you take, especially those for blood thinners, diabetes, or heart conditions. Maintaining a consistent time of day for taking the medication aids absorption.

Regular monitoring of your thyroid hormone levels is crucial. This allows your doctor to adjust your dosage as needed and to address any side effects quickly.
